Shahbuddinpur Population - Kheri, Uttar Pradesh
Shahbuddinpur is a medium size village located in Lakhimpur Tehsil of Kheri district, Uttar Pradesh with total 52 families residing. The Shahbuddinpur village has population of 320 of which 179 are males while 141 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Shahbuddinpur village population of children with age 0-6 is 18 which makes up 5.63 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Shahbuddinpur village is 788 which is lower than Uttar Pradesh state average of 912. Child Sex Ratio for the Shahbuddinpur as per census is 500, lower than Uttar Pradesh average of 902.
Shahbuddinpur village has higher literacy rate compared to Uttar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Shahbuddinpur village was 84.44 % compared to 67.68 % of Uttar Pradesh. In Shahbuddinpur Male literacy stands at 89.22 % while female literacy rate was 78.52 %.
